I am able to get event notifications on kafka by applying these
configurations:
nova.conf
instance_usage_audit = True
instance_usage_audit_period = hour
notify_on_state_change = vm_and_task_state
notification_driver = messagingv2
Restart nova compute service
ceilometer.conf
[event]
drop_unmatched_notifications = False
definitions_cfg_file = /etc/ceilometer/event_definitions.yaml
event_pipeline.yaml
---
sources:
- name: event_source
events:
- compute.instance.*
sinks:
- event_sink
sinks:
- name: event_sink
transformers:
triggers:
publishers:
#- notifier://
#- file:///home/stack/test?max_bytes=10000000&backup_count=5
- kafka://kafka-broker:9092?topic=ceilometer
service ceilometer-api restart
service ceilometer-agent-notification restart
Wait for couple of minutes and you should be getting the events on your
kafka consumer and in ceilometer notifications logs as well
tail -f /var/log/ceilometer/ceilometer-agent-notification.log

> How can instance created and deleted information/sample can be retrieved
> from ceilometer.
> What entries should be there in pipeline.yaml to get instance deleted
> information.
>
> I tried to have meters- "instance" in pipeline.yam but it always gives
> active instance details,
> and no details of deleted instances.
